Output e2965062b6cf5497c11b62b413f08c78e051cfafd6a38c71a15416188aefcf5b:1

value
405223417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c78928ae3b5ad0b9e50ef5ded4deba950477bc5d OP_EQUALVERIFY OP_CHECKSIG
address
1KC3n9FfwPqdFmZ6xjKvmwqHSpcE85LwB8
transaction
e2965062b6cf5497c11b62b413f08c78e051cfafd6a38c71a15416188aefcf5b
confirmations
418031
spent
true